在xCode中加载自定义UIF字体

Pet*_*rtz 2 iphone xcode objective-c ios

所以我实际上遇到了几个问题.首先,我想在iOS应用程序中使用"Font Suitcase"文件作为自定义字体,但无法使其工作.不仅如此,我还没能正确使用.ttf文件.以下是我尝试使其工作的步骤:

  1. 将文件导入xCode中的支持文件.
  2. 在Info.plist文件中添加了文件名,例如"badaboom.TTF"
  3. 被称为UIFont*myFont = [UIFont fontWithName:@"Badaboom"大小:20.0];

我还使用这里找到的代码来查看字体是否被加载,它也没有出现.这适用于ttf和字体行李箱文件.

知道我做错了什么吗?

谢谢,皮特

Ale*_*der 9

您必须将字体添加为资源.

请执行以下步骤:

  • 转到您的项目设置
  • 选择目标
  • 转到构建阶段
  • 将自定义字体添加到Copy Bundle Resources

有了这个和您发布的代码,您现在应该能够加载自定义字体